| Metric | Central Michigan University | Northern Michigan University |
|---|---|---|
| Acceptance Rate | 91% | 70% |
| Annual In-State Tuition | $15,030 | $13,374 |
| Annual Out-of-State Tuition | $15,030 | $18,996 |
| Endowment (End of Year) | $913,123,769 | $370,777,813 |
| Room and Board | $12,394 | $13,136 |
| Total Cost of Attendance (In-State) | $27,424 | $26,510 |
| Total Cost of Attendance (Out-of-State) | $27,424 | $32,132 |
| Total Student Enrollment | 14,399 | 7,197 |
